Output 04347580708a0fb589e69372d04c8b1b71467440efd111364a8a8230d53bd60d:78

value
43971
script pubkey
OP_0 OP_PUSHBYTES_20 4bb3e6c34e66fd5c5d8f02a30a0f0597ffd81107
address
bc1qfwe7ds6wvm74chv0q23s5rc9jllasyg8vt9vy6
transaction
04347580708a0fb589e69372d04c8b1b71467440efd111364a8a8230d53bd60d
spent
true